Traits
Swift Swim
Ability Slot 1
Boosts the Pokémon's Speed stat in rain.
Doubles Speed during rain.
Storm Drain
Ability Slot 2
The Pokémon draws in all Water-type moves. Instead of taking damage from them, its Sp. Atk stat is boosted.
Redirects single-target Water moves to this Pokémon where possible. Absorbs Water moves, raising Special Attack one stage.
Water Veil(Hidden Ability)
The Pokémon's water veil prevents it from being burned.
Prevents burns.
